Investigative journalist Shona Sandison is attending the wedding of her closest friend and former colleague, Vivienne. But the night before the wedding, Vivās reclusive school friend, Dan, jumps from a roof to his death. Shona is the only witness to the suicideāand so the only person who saw the occult tattoos covering Danās body, and heard the unsettling, mystical phrases he was uttering.
Compelled to look further into the tragic incident, Shona sets off on a quest to find out why Dan killed himself and what happened to Vivās missing brother twenty years prior. Despite knowing that investigating Vivās family will mean she could lose her friend forever, Shona travels to a small, forgotten town in the north of England to investigate an insular group of classmates who have held a dark secret for decades.
Haunting and hypnotic, The Hollow Tree is a return to Philip Millerās dark world of subterfuge, betrayal, and fragile justice.
